Brachiopoda—Phylum overview

• Solitary (but individuals often live in clusters)• Bivalved, with each valve being bilaterally

symmetrical• Marine; mostly shallow marine (100–200m), but

can occur in depths >2000m• Attached by pedicle or unattached; some

infaunal• Filter feeders

Brachiopoda—Phylum overview

• Possibly share a common ancestor with bryozoans (both groups possess a lophophore)

• Stratigraphic range is Early Cambrian to Recent• Peak diversity in Ordovician, Devonian,

Permian• Major reduction coincident with end-Permian

mass extinction• Mesozoic peak diversity in Jurassic

Brachiopod morphology• Ventral valve (a.k.a. “pedicle valve”)

– Lower or bottom valve

• Dorsal valve (a.k.a. “brachial valve”)– Upper or top valve

• Foramen = pedicle opening (largely or entirely in pedicle valve)

• Anterior = end of shell opposite foramen• Posterior = end of shell containing foramen• Commissure = line along which two valves meet• Hinge = articulation mechanism

– Teeth in pedicle valve; sockets in brachial valve

Brachiopod morphology

• Shells may be highly ornamented– Growth lines (concentric)– Ribs (radial)– Fold (major raised area)– Sulcus (major depressed area)– Spines (sometimes extensions of growth

lamellae; sometimes discrete structures)

Features of the posterior region (pedicle and hinge region)

• Pedicle opening– Delthyrium = triagular opening in pedicle

valve– Notothyrium = smaller opening in brachial

valve– Interarea = planar or curved surface between

“beak” and hingeline• Ventral interarea• Dorsal interarea

Internal features

• Body cavity houses major organs in posterior region of shell

• Mantle cavity in anterior region of shell is mostly open space

• Lophophore = ciliated, arm-like structure that serves for respiration and food gathering

• Pedicle = muscular stalk for attachment to external objects or substrate

• Adductor and diductor muscles

Lophophore

• Usually a two-part structure, with each half (brachium; plural brachia) leading to the mouth

• May be complexly looped or coiled

• May be supported by a mineralized structure—spiralium (plural spiralia) or brachidium (plural brachidia)

Class Inarticulata

• Lingula ia an example of a “living fossil”

• Relatively low diversity since Ordovician time

• Infaunal, with long fleshy pedicle
